Pipeline anxiety analysts usually do pipeline stress and anxiety analysis using the dirt stamina values given by geotechnical engineers. These values show the stress and anxiety level the dirt can tolerate without undergoing too much deformations.
Overestimating the load-bearing capability too a lot can result in excessive deformation or even failing of the pipe in severe problems. On the other hand, undervaluing the dirt's load-bearing capability can result in utilizing an overdesigned pipeline. In circumstances where pipe failures do take place, forensic geotechnical engineers investigate whether the dirt toughness was examined effectively and whether the layout team overstated the load-bearing capability of the dirts in the pipe area.
Each terrain offers certain difficulties for the style and building of the pipeline. Since the style of pipes requires to be consistent with the geologic terrain, the shear toughness of the soil is an essential factor in analyzing pipe movement on sloping locations. On the other hand, dirt dilatancy (the propensity of dirt to broaden when sheared) must be represented in seismic areas to prevent extreme anxieties on the pipe during a quake.

Selecting the proper pipe installment technique for some sections of the pipe path can be essential to making certain long-lasting efficiency and stability, whereas picking an incorrect setup technique might result in failure. Choosing an open-cut installment approach instead of horizontal directional exploration (HDD) in an area with deep natural deposits can boost the chance of upheaval fastening and pipe failing.
